Description

Built in the 1970s of reconstituted stone beneath a tiled roof, this modern detached home, which has been updated over recent years, benefits from ample driveway parking, a single garage and rear garden. The well presented accommodation comprises entrance porch, entrance lobby, dining kitchen, sitting room and study to the ground floor, with three bedrooms, bathroom and separate WC to the first floor. The property is well suited to the growing family, professional couple or active retirees.

Tansley boasts a thriving community with highly regarded primary school and two popular public houses. Good road communications lead to the neighbouring market towns of Matlock. Bakewell, Chesterfield and Alfreton, with the cities of Sheffield, Derby and Nottingham each within daily commuting distance. The delights of the Derbyshire Dales and Peak District are on the doorstep.

ACCOMMODATION
From the brick and tiled porch, a uPVC double glazed front door opens to an entrance lobby with stairs rising to the first floor and new oak doors (which continue throughout the property) open to the sitting room and...

Dining kitchen - a dual aspect room with windows overlooking both the front and rear gardens, the kitchen is well fitted with ample modern cupboards, drawers and work surfaces which incorporate a black composite sink unit and gas hob with contemporary black extractor hood over. There is an eye level electric oven, integral microwave, integral dishwasher and plumbing for an automatic washing machine. There is additional space for a free standing fridge / freezer and to one end of the work surfaces is a useful breakfast bar. A door opens to the rear entrance lobby with stable style door providing access to the rear garden, a second door opens to a useful under stairs store, and a third door opens to the...

Sitting room - a spacious reception room with window overlooking the front garden, plus door allowing access from the entrance lobby. A door opens into the...

Study - a useful and versatile room, ideal as a study, hobby space or dining room, as required. Side facing window.

From the entrance lobby, stairs rise to the first floor landing with two useful stores and doors leading off to the bedrooms, bathroom and WC.

Bedroom 1 - a good double bedroom with front facing window and useful store over the stairs.

Bathroom - fitted with a panelled bath with shower over and pedestal wash hand basin. There is dark contemporary tiling and rear facing obscured glazed window.

Separate WC - with a WC and wash hand basin. Rear facing obscure glazed window.

Bedroom 2 - a second double bedroom with rear facing window.

Bedroom 3 - a comfortable double bedroom with front facing window.

OUTSIDE & PARKING
A block paved driveway provides ample parking to both the front of the property and side and leads to a single garage with up and over door, light and power. A flagged pathway leads past mature planting to the front porch. Boundary hedging encloses the front of the property.

To the rear of the property, steps rise to a flagged area with another set of steps rising to the main garden which is laid to lawn with mature shrubs, trees and other planting which offer a degree of privacy. To the head of the garden is a flagged seating area.
